US Passport Photo Requirements

Official specifications from the U.S. Department of State

📐 Size & Dimensions

Photo must be 2×2 inches (51×51 mm)

  • Head height: 1 to 1⅜ inches
  • Eye level: 1⅛ to 1⅜ inches from bottom
  • Print on matte or glossy paper

📸 Photo Quality

High resolution, in focus, proper exposure

  • Taken within last 6 months
  • Color photo (no black & white)
  • Natural skin tones

⚪ Background

Plain white or off-white only

  • No patterns or textures
  • No shadows on background
  • Uniform color throughout

👤 Head Position

Face forward, directly at camera

  • Head straight (not tilted)
  • Full face view, ears visible
  • Eyes open and clearly visible

😐 Expression

Neutral expression, mouth closed

  • No smiling with teeth
  • Both eyes open
  • Natural expression

👓 Glasses & Accessories

Generally not allowed

  • Remove eyeglasses (unless medical)
  • No sunglasses or tinted lenses
  • No headphones or devices

Can I take my own passport photo at home?
While DIY photos are technically allowed, professional services ensure precise government specifications. Professional photos reduce the risk of passport application rejection.
How quickly can I get passport photos in Citrus Heights?
Most passport photo services can complete your pictures in 5-10 minutes. Digital and printed versions are usually available immediately after capturing.
What are the US passport photo requirements?
Passport photos must be 2×2 inches with a plain white or off-white background. Subjects must face directly toward the camera with a neutral expression.
Can I smile in my passport photo?
Passport photos require a neutral facial expression with both eyes open. Slight, natural smiles are acceptable, but wide grins are not permitted.
Do I need an appointment for passport photos?
Most passport photo services welcome walk-ins without prior scheduling. During busy periods, a short wait might be necessary.
What should I wear for my passport photo?
Wear everyday attire avoiding white tops that might blend with the background. Avoid accessories that obscure facial features like large hats or sunglasses.
